Document Controller Cover Letter Examples

Document Controllers are in charge for managing company documents and helping them to become more efficient and to adhere to various policies. Successful Document Controllers should be able to complete the following duties: storing and organizing company documents, archiving inactive records, handling the retrieval of documents, processing requests for information, developing new templates, assisting with audits, and coordinating file migrations. Document Controllers may also be required to complete a range of administrative tasks.

Free Document Controller cover letter example

Dear Mr. Marfallo:

As an experienced and skillful professional with seven years of comprehensive experience managing and organizing corporate documents to ensure full availability and accuracy, I am confident I can make an immediate and substantial impact on your company’s success as your next Document Controller.

My background lies in managing proper document storage and accessibility while communicating routinely across multiple departments and teams to implement document management and control procedures. With a solid history of managing all facets of document control, I also excel at leading teams and redesigning processes to maximize efficiency and accuracy.

My qualifications include the following:

Directing document control operations across all departments—including compliance, HR, finance, and sales—as Document Controller for Stamper Manufacturing to facilitate expedient and accurate document management and storage.

Utilizing keen technical proficiency to utilize and update complex systems, prepare purchase orders to meet audit requirements, and cross-reference project tags across a high volume of documentation.

Demonstrating first-rate organizational, interpersonal, and time management abilities throughout my career while thriving in detail-oriented, deadline-driven atmospheres.

Earning a Bachelor of Science in Business Administration; currently pursuing my MBA degree.

With my dedication to driving efficient and accurate document control functions, combined with my finely honed leadership and communication skills, I believe I would be an excellent addition to your team. I look forward to discussing the position with you further. Thank you for your consideration.

Sincerely,

Angela W. Rodriguez

Include These Document Controller Skills

  • Organization and planning
  • The ability to prioritize tasks
  • Strong communication and networking skills
  • Customer service orientation
  • Attention to details and accuracy
  • Computer proficiency
  • Teamwork and the ability to work independently
  • Confidentiality and integrity
  • Business acumen
